The dining experience here centers around customizable hotpot sets, offering diners a variety of options. Customers can select from pork, chicken, or beef as their main protein, catering to different tastes and dietary preferences. Pricing is accessible, starting at $15 for a single serving and scaling up to $60 for a set that serves five people.

Each hotpot set is presented in an elegant wooden box, elevating the overall presentation. The sets are generously packed with fresh ingredients, including the chosen meat, fish, quail eggs, luncheon meat, fish balls, crab sticks, prawns, minced meat, mushrooms, tang hoon (glass noodles), and assorted vegetables. One Pot currently specializes in offering a single hotpot soup base: the Japanese Pork Bone, or tonkotsu. According to the restaurant’s menu and customer reviews, no other soup bases are available at this time.

This focus on one soup base is notable, as many hotpot restaurants typically provide multiple options, such as spicy Sichuan or herbal broths (Eater, 2023). However, the Japanese pork bone soup is praised for its deep, umami-rich flavor that complements a wide range of meats and vegetables. The creamy texture and savory profile result from simmering pork bones for several hours, a method widely recognized in Japanese cuisine (Japan Centre, 2022).

Accompanying the soup are two house-made chili dipping sauces. One is distinctly spicy, while the other features a sweeter undertone. These sauces add complexity and allow diners to customize each bite.

One Pot (一锅)  

Address: 56 Jalan Benaan Kapal, Stall #54, Singapore 399644  

Phone: +65 9007 7959  

Nearest MRT Stations: Stadium (Circle Line), Tanjong Rhu (Thomson-East Coast Line)

Opening Times:  

Tuesday to Sunday: 6:00pm – 10:00pm  

Closed on Mondays

How to Get There:

From Stadium MRT (CC Line):  

Disembark at Stadium MRT and use Exit B. Head towards Stadium Walk, cross the large open-air carpark, then continue to Stadium Crescent Road. Cross the road and proceed onto Jalan Benaan Kapal — your destination will be along this road. The walk takes around 10 minutes. [Map]

From Tanjong Rhu MRT (TE Line):  

Get off at Tanjong Rhu MRT and exit via Exit 2. Walk towards the river and cross the bridge leading to the indoor stadium. Go through the open-air carpark in the direction of Stadium Crescent Road, follow it, and then turn onto Jalan Benaan Kapal. Walking time is about 10 minutes.
